Can I offer to pay for the day at a club?

Some clubs might offer a guest voucher for the day if you pay in the golf shop. But really, if you want to offer to pay, do it with your host ahead of time. It can look tacky to do so while you’re at the club.

Do you tip at a private club?

The locker-room attendant and the folks getting and cleaning your clubs are the usual suspects to tip. If the attendant shines your shoes, try to throw him a couple bucks. How do you join friends on PGA 2k21?

You first setup an in-game party and invite friends you want to play from there. After that you setup the game and they will receive invites to your game. If they miss the invite they can join by selecting join group match from the main game menu.

How do you play everybody's golf online with friends?

It is organized by a room system and to begin setting one up, press Options once you're in an online mode, whether that be Open Course or Turf War. Then, choose Online and then Game Room. Here you will be able to set up your own room for friends to join, or search for one that has already been created.

How do you play with 2 controllers on PGA Tour 2k21?

To the right of your golfer is says "Press (insert button here) to add a player". If you press the "insert button here) button on the second controller, it should add a second player and that player will now be controlled by the second controller. The second controller can now customize the look of that player.

What to do when someone asks you your opinion on a rule?

If you’re playing with a group of strangers and someone asks your opinion on a rules situation they are in, be honest, but don’t hold their feet to the fire. They are likely seeking your honest opinion, but they don’t need someone to cite the rule for them. Just tell them how you’d play it if you were playing by yourself and move on. A good way to approach rules situations with strangers is never giving your opinion unsolicited.

What happens when you join a private golf club?

When you join a private club, it opens up so many opportunities to play OTHER private clubs as well. There are inter-club tournaments and you start getting to know people through golf that are members elsewhere. So the idea that once you join a club that is the only course you play, is just inaccurate. Before I joined a club, I had played a couple of private courses through tournaments, etc. However, within 2 years of joining my club, I had played every top club in the area through connections made at the club.

Can you pay for a golf club with a guest?

If you are a guest at a private club the host will likely be picking up the tab. Some clubs might offer a guest voucher for the day if you pay in the golf shop. But really, if you want to offer to pay, do it with your host ahead of time. It can look tacky to do so while you’re at the club.

Do you have to wait outside for locker room?

You don't have to wait outside or in the locker room if you arrive early. It’s totally cool to go warm up in the practice area. Tell someone at the bag drop or in the locker room that you’re a guest of [Insert name here] and they’ll make you feel at home. Photo By: Andrew Kaufman.

Do clubs accept cash?

Most clubs will welcome your money in their shop. Some private clubs will only charge a member’s account for merchandise. But most shops will accept cash or a credit card.

Do you need a handicap to play golf?

The only requirement? Make sure you’re not holding folks up with your slow play. Your host will let you know if you need a handicap.

Can you pay for both caddies?

You can offer, and should always offer to pay for both caddies. A pro move is to do so before getting to the course. Oh, and don’t forget to bring cash. A lot of clubs don't have an ATM.
